Where did the Rubik's Cube come from?

Rubik’s Cube is een puzzel die is uitgevonden door de professor Erno Rubik uit Hongarije. Hij maakte de eerste versie van de kubus in 1974. In eerste instantie ontwierp Rubik de kubus om zijn studenten te helpen driedimensionale uitdagingen te begrijpen. Al snel realiseerde hij zich dat zijn uitvinding ook een uitdagende puzzel was! De Cube heette in eerste instantie Magic Cube, maar later werd dit veranderd naar Rubik’s Cube toen het als speedcube wereldwijd populair werd. In 1980 werd Rubik’s Cube officieel gelanceerd op een internationale speelgoedbeurs en groeide het al snel uit tot een wereldwijd fenomeen.

Who invented the cube?

Over the years, many different people have contributed to the cube, but one of its earliest designers was Erno Rubik, a professor from Hungary who, in 1974, initially made it out of 27 wooden blocks for his students to illustrate a mathematical concept. Rubik wasn’t sure if there was a solution, so it took him a month to solve the puzzle himself first.

What is the world record for speedcubing?

Op een spannend evenement in Long Beach, heeft een jonge deelnemer uit Californië iedereen verbaasd door de 3x3x3 kubus op te lossen in een ongelofelijke tijd. Met een verbazingwekkende nieuwe wereldrecordtijd van slechts 3,13 seconden heeft Max Park bewezen een ware speedcube kampioen te zijn. Deze prestatie is maar liefst 0,34 seconden sneller dan het vorige record, dat al ruim 4 jaar onverslagen bleef.

What is the difference between the various mechanisms used in speedcubes?

Speedcubing is all about fast and smooth movements, and manufacturers have developed various mechanisms to optimize the performance of these cubes. Let’s explore the most common mechanisms:

Ball-core Mechanism: uses a spherical core in the center of the cube. This core provides stability and ensures smoother rotations because the pieces rotate around the sphere. Although this mechanism may be slightly more complex to manufacture and may feel a bit heavier to some users, it also helps reduce jamming during rotation.

Maglev Mechanisme: maglev staat voor magnetische levitatie en vervangt de traditionele veren door magneten. Hierdoor wordt de interne wrijving aanzienlijk verminderd, wat resulteert in zeer soepele en stille bewegingen. Bovendien zorgt magnetische levitatie voor een gelijkmatigere spanning binnen de kubus. Hoewel dit mechanisme zeer geavanceerd is, kan het ook prijziger zijn, en sommige gebruikers hebben een aanpassingsperiode nodig om te wennen aan het ontbreken van traditionele veertegenstand.

Magnetic Mechanism: integrates small magnets into the individual pieces of the cube. These magnets attract each other and ensure that the pieces click precisely into place as they rotate. This provides clear tactile feedback and ensures stable, fast movements, minimizing unintended rotations and overshoot (a situation in which a rotation goes further than intended). Although the magnetic mechanism may make the cube slightly heavier due to the presence of the magnets, it does provide a significant improvement in stability and precision.

Enhanced-core Mechanism: features improved internal structures that utilize innovative materials and designs to enhance the cube’s overall performance. These mechanisms offer improved durability and precision, especially at higher speeds. Enhanced-core mechanisms reduce friction and wear, resulting in a smooth and consistent experience over the long term. Additionally, they offer improved stability, minimizing the likelihood of pops (where pieces pop out of the cube). Although these mechanisms may be more complex and costly, they increase the cube’s value through their improved performance and durability.

Waar zijn de uiterlijke kenmerken van een speedcube goed voor?

UV-Coating: Een populaire keuze is de UV-coating. Hoewel ze mogelijk wat gladder zijn, voelen deze kubussen premium aan. Een UV-afwerking is een specifieke soort glanzende coating die wordt bereikt door het aanbrengen van een speciale lak die vervolgens wordt uitgehard onder ultraviolet (UV) licht. Naast een glanzende uitstraling biedt de UV-afwerking extra bescherming tegen krassen en slijtage, waardoor de cube zeer duurzaam is.

Frosted: A frosted finish is a slightly rough, grainy texture with a subtle, soft sheen. This texture makes fingerprints and smudges less visible, provides a better grip, and offers increased resistance to scratches and wear.

Matte: Een speedcube met een mat uiterlijk heeft een vlak, niet-glanzend oppervlak dat consistent en gelijkmatig is in textuur en uitstraling, zonder variaties of onregelmatigheden een afwerking die volledig non-reflecterend is. Deze textuur vermindert de zichtbaarheid van vingerafdrukken en vlekken, biedt extra grip en zorgt voor een rustiger visueel uiterlijk zonder reflecties.

Black: Traditional speed cubes often have a black base plastic, which creates a strong visual contrast with the colored stickers. Stickers offer many customization options, but can wear out or come loose over time. As an alternative, many cubers opt for stickerless cubes, which use colored plastic pieces and eliminate the risk of sticker wear. These remain vibrant and are easy to maintain, although some competitions once had restrictions on their use.

Primary: For a more subtle look, there are cubes made of primary plastic—light gray or off-white base plastic—that offer a more subdued appearance. Although the visual contrast with the colored surfaces is less striking than with black cubes, they do have a unique and appealing aesthetic.

Gummy: There’s also the gummy texture, also known as a gummy finish. This rubbery coating provides extra grip, which is especially useful for cubers with sweaty hands. It allows for better control while turning, though it may feel a bit sticky to some users.

Glossy: Another popular choice is the glossy finish, which creates a shiny, reflective surface. Although visually appealing, a glossy finish may offer slightly less grip compared to matte or rubberized finishes.

Jelly: Jelly speedcubes stand out for their unique and eye-catching design. These cubes feature a translucent, pastel-colored finish that gives them a fresh, colorful look. The brightly colored, semi-transparent pieces make the cube visually appealing and playful. Despite their distinctive appearance, jelly cubes offer the same texture as standard plastic cubes, without the extra grip of a gummy finish. For speedcubers who are looking not only for performance but also for a cube with a unique look, jelly cubes are the perfect choice.

Metallic: For those looking for something truly unique, there’s also a metallic coating. These provide a striking sheen and a distinctive look; they’re primarily for decorative purposes and aren’t standard in the speedcubing world.
